WinXP中如何解决备份文件夹拒绝访问问题
2010-05-22 22:14
549 查看
WinXP中如何解决备份文件夹拒绝访问问题
在重新安装Windows XP系统前,为了避免重要数据文件丢失,笔者将“我的文档”中的文件备份到D盘中,格式化C盘后重新安装了Windows XP,安装完成后发现使用原来的用户账号无法访问D盘的备份文件。为什么会出现拒绝访问的问题呢?原因分析:笔者的电脑采用NTFS文件系统,因此所有的文件或文件夹都会受到ACL(访问控制权限)的限制。虽然重装系统前后都是使用“RTJ”这个账号访问Windows中的文件,但这里要注意的是每个访问账号都对应一个唯一的SID(安全标志符), ACL的功能就是通过SID来判断该账号是否可以访问某个文件。
虽然重装系统后,笔者同样是使用“RTJ”账号来访问它,但这时的“RTJ”账号所对应的SID却已经和以前的不相同了。因此就出现了重装系统后,“RTJ”账号无法访问备份文件夹的情况。
解决问题:解决这个拒绝访问的问题其实非常简单,在备份文件夹的“安全”标签页中重新赋予“RTJ”账号访问权限即可。
第一步:以“Administrator”账号登录系统,在资源管理器中点击“工具→选项”,在弹出的“文件夹选项”对话框中切换到“查看”标签页,取消“使用简单文件共享”前面的“√”,最后点击“确定”按钮(这样设置的目的,是为了在备份文件夹的属性对话框中找到“安全”标签页)。
第二步:右键点击D盘中的备份文件夹,选择“属性”选项,在弹出的属性对话框中切换到“安全”标签页,这时你就会在“组或用户名称”栏中发现一个“未知账号”项目(图1),这就是重装系统前的“RTJ”账号,由于重新安装系统后,SID值发生了变化,所以系统无法识别这个账号,也就导致了“RTJ”账号被拒绝访问。
图 1
首先删除这个未知账号,然后点击安全标签页中的“高级”按钮,弹出“高级安全设置”对话框,切换到“所有者”标签页,这时会发现备份文件的所有者是未知账号,当然“RTJ”账号无法访问了。接着将所有者修改为“RTJ”账号(图2),还要记住选中下方的“替换子容器及对象的所有者”选项,点击“应用”按钮。
图 2
第三步:在“高级安全设置”对话框中切换到“有效权限”标签页,点击“添加”按钮,将“RTJ”账号添加到“权限项目”列表框中。在添加账号过程中要注意一定要给“RTJ”账号赋予“完全控制”的权限,最后点击“确定”按钮,完成修改操作。这样“RTJ”账号就能访问备份文件夹中的文件,而不会再出现拒绝访问的状况。
相关文章推荐
- WinXP中如何解决备份文件夹拒绝访问问题(转东转西)
- XP中如何解决备份文件夹拒绝访问问题(也可解决普通用户访问管理员用户的文件的权限问题)
- XP中如何解决备份文件夹拒绝访问问题(也可解决普通用户访问管理员用户的文件的权限问题)
- 如何解决IIS停止后重启,IIS重装后出现弹出对话框“拒绝您访问此计算机”问题
- winxp下文件夹拒绝访问的解决方法
- 如何解决FineReader中访问文件被拒绝的问题
- 还原WSS3.0备份时,遇到“对路径"spbrtoc.xml"的访问被拒绝”问题的解决方法
- 如何解决ABBYY FineReader安装过程中出现“拒绝访问……”问题
- 如何解决ABBYY FineReader安装过程中出现“拒绝访问……”问题
- 如何解决Asp.Net Ajax 1.0跨域名框架情况下javascript“访问拒绝”的问题[翻译]
- 如何解决备份访问映射配置错误无法访问的问题
- 关于redis主从备份,主机拒绝写入问题 java客户端为保障正常运行该如何操作?( 自码待解决问)
- 【转】针对类似文件夹无法删除update:访问拒绝的问题解决办法
- 如何解决 NFS 目录访问被挂住的问题
- 简单的问题有时也要技巧:“尝试打开文件夹时出现“Access is Denied”(拒绝访问)错误信息”
- oozie 执行examples 报80020端口拒绝访问问题解决汇总
- "SQL Server不存在或访问被拒绝"问题解决
- Win10下Visual Studio 2015编译报“无法注册程序集***dll- 拒绝访问。请确保您正在以管理员身份运行应用程序。对注册表项”***“的访问被拒绝。”问题解决
- “SQL Server不存在或访问被拒绝”问题的解决
- Spring 是如何解决并发访问的线程安全性问题的